You can create many things with lines, from simple line drawings to using lines for shades and dimensions. I focused my work on architecture in New York City this semester. In doing research, I chose the Guggenheim Museum as a focal point. The Guggenheim Museum, designed by Frank Lloyd Wright, is known for its organic shapes. I started off by going to the museum and taking pictures of the structure and areas I would want to draw; after I simplified the picture by outlining shapes, I later filled it in with lines to show shade. In doing this, I created a set of three. I then moved on to working digitally and went in a different direction; instead of lines as the shade, I used different colors.
